Gottschalk wins at No. 3 singles, but Rochester falls to Wabash
BY VAL TSOUTSOURIS
Sports Editor, RTC
Boys tennis

Wabash 4, Rochester 1 (Wednesday): Luke Gottschalk won in three sets at No. 3 singles, but the visiting Zebras lost to conference and sectional rival Wabash Wednesday.
Gottschalk won 6-1, 4-6, 6-3.
Camden Zink won the second set of his match at No. 1 singles in a tiebreak before losing 6-3 in the third set. Griffin Newton won his first set 6-4 at No. 2 singles but did not win a game over the final two sets.
Logan Fuller and Jesse Smith lost in straight sets at No. 1 doubles, and Cash Casper and Ayden Smith lost in straight sets at No. 2 doubles.
Rochester is 3-8.
